Chris Buffa (Modojo): According to many, Nintendo's March 27 3DS launch was a huge disappointment. The system was overpriced at $249.99, consumers complained the glasses free 3D gave them headaches and a lack of compelling software (the absence of Mario the biggest sticking point) gave shoppers little reason to fork over their hard-earned dough.

In Japan, they'd sold out their entire allocation in the first two days. It was the most successful Nintendo console launch ever in America and the UK.
The problem was the three months after that. Those good first week sales didn't last.
They sold 4 million first quarter - but 3.5 million of that was in the first week.
